12275746bfed83e249c7aa74eaa4e6c18b07ef9134098582140218143d1ccc1a

1103114 (474842 blocks ago)

⏴ Block 1103113 (cef9c913...bfb) | Block 1103115 ⏵ | Latest block ⏭

Metadata

7/15/22, 6:30 PM UTC (659d 12:04:17 ago) 19.1 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details